Interactive fiction is a way of storytelling where you, as the reader or player, get to make choices that affect how the story unfolds. By using a specific type of software, writers create these branching storylines and design different paths and outcomes based on the reader’s decisions. Depending on the software and the potential outcomes, writers don’t even need a huge amount of technical knowledge. There are several open-source and free tools to do this.
